Here is a step-by-step guide on how you can connect Shopify to Quick, and books online. Sign in to your Quick. Books Online account. Go to the Apps section, then find and install Shopify Connector by Intuit. You will then be redirected to the Connections tab in Quick. Books Connector (One. Saas).

What is QuickBooks for Shopify and how does it work?
, quick Books for Shopify allows you to seamlessly export all of your Shopify sales to Quick. Books, directly from your admin. With a single click, your order data (including line items and taxes) are automatically sent to your Quick. Books Online account.

It allows you to quickly and easily import all of your Shopify orders and refunds into QBO. You can either automatically sync the data or export it manually by setting the desired date range. You’ll be able to automatically match up your shop’s payouts and fees, including order details such as line items, taxes, and shipping.
